General Admission Requirements

Admission to Throneroom College of Nursing Sciences, Kafanchan is merit-based and competitive

Applicants must:

  • Demonstrate good moral character and discipline.
  • Satisfy the academic requirements as stipulated for the ND/HND Nursing programme.
  • Meet the age requirement as prescribed by regulatory bodies (16 years and above).
  • Provide evidence of medical fitness.
  • Pass in all required examinations and interviews
Admission Requirements for National Diploma (ND) Programme

Applicants for the ND Nursing Programme must:

  • Have successfully completed Senior Secondary School Certificate (SSCE/WAEC/NECO/NABTEB).
  • Obtain a minimum of five (5) credit passes including required subjects (see Section 3.4) in not more than two sittings.
  • Meet the minimum age requirement (16 years by the time of admission).
  • Satisfy any additional criteria set by the College, NBTE, and NMCN
Admission Requirements for Higher National Diploma (HND) Programme

Applicants for the HND Nursing Programme must:

  • Have successfully completed the ND Nursing Programme with a minimum lower credit pass.
  • Meet the minimum duration of clinical practice or supervised work experience as required.
  • Satisfy other additional criteria set by the College, NMCN and NBTE.
